Define each term in your own words.
10. line of fit
A line of fit is a line that closely fits the data points from a scatter plot, even if all
of the data points do not lie on that line. (answers may vary)
11. linear extrapolation
Linear extrapolation is the process of using a linear equation to predict a y-value
for an x-value that lies outside the x-values of the original data set.
